This one’s for the “Witchy Women.”On Halloween weekend, the Eagles are scheduled to perform a pair of back-to-back concerts at Las Vegas Sphere on Friday, Oct.31 and Saturday, Nov.
1 as part of their ongoing residency at the eye-popping events space.And, if you want to be there to celebrate the spooky holiday with the legendary classic rockers, last-minute tickets are still available.At the time of publication, the lowest price we could find on tickets for the pair of gigs was $296 including fees on Vivid Seats.In the event that’s too rich for your blood, Don Henley, Joe Walsh and co.have ten more shows lined up at Sphere from November through February 2026.Prices for those concerts have seats starting anywhere from $241 to $420 including fees.Based on our findings at Set List FM, the Rock Hall of Famers typically perform approximately 20 songs per concert at each and every Sin City spot.
They run the gamut from chart-topping hits (“Hotel California,” “Take It to the Limit,” “Life In The Fast Lane,” “Desperado” and “Heartache Tonight”) to Henley/Walsh solo favorites (“Boys Of Summer,” “Life’s Been Good,” “In The City” and “Rocky Mountain Way”) and slightly deep cuts like “I Can’t Tell You Why,” “Those Shoes” and “Seven Bridges Road.”However, the timeless music is only part of what makes these Eagles concerts so special.Sphere also delivers world-class visuals that make these live shows so unique and vital.“The eye candy incredibly matched the music, and everyone will have their own takeaways about what resonated the most,” media company Gonzo Okanagan noted in a review of their September 2024 opening night Sphere show.
